    Sup guys-

    New to the board here.

    Anyways, I was in NYC last weekend at Columbia University, and I walked in to the gym there, and Darko was there working on his game with his trainer. HE IS FOR REAL. He is fluid, quick, and HUGE. He was dunking with medicine balls, and shooting the three with ease.

    People that have compared him more to Nowitzki, probably because they're both foreign, but he looked more like a Garnett to me.

    Anyways, I also got him to sign my Ben Wallace jersey, shook his hand, and wished him luck in the NBA and with the Pistons (book it, he was wearing Pistons gear in his workout, he's going to the Pistons).
